在当前数字化转型加速推进的背景下,企业对供应链管理的精细化、实时化要求日益提升。面对外部环境波动加剧、客户需求多样化以及内部运营效率瓶颈,越来越多的企业开始意识到,依赖传统手工或半自动化流程已难以支撑现代供应链的高效运转。此时,构建一套自主可控的SCM系统开发方案,成为实现降本增效、增强市场响应能力的关键路径。无论是制造型企业、零售平台还是 logistics 服务商,都亟需通过技术手段打通采购、库存、物流、供应商协同等核心环节的数据链路,真正实现端到端的可视化与智能化管理。而“SCM系统开发”不再只是信息化部门的任务,更应上升为全链条业务协同的战略举措。
明确需求:从业务痛点出发梳理核心模块
任何成功的SCM系统开发,都始于对真实业务场景的深度理解。企业在启动项目前,必须系统梳理自身在供应链各环节存在的实际问题。例如,采购周期过长是否因供应商信息不透明?库存积压严重是否源于需求预测不准?订单履约延迟是否因为物流数据无法实时同步?这些问题的背后,往往指向了数据孤岛、流程断点和人工干预过多等共性难题。因此,在需求分析阶段,应聚焦四大核心模块:采购管理(含合同与订单跟踪)、库存控制(多仓库、多级库存优化)、物流调度(运输计划与状态追踪)以及供应商协同(绩效评估与准入机制)。通过访谈关键岗位人员、分析历史运营报表,将抽象问题转化为可量化的功能指标,是确保后续开发不偏离目标的重要前提。

架构设计:微服务与API集成的实战选择
随着系统规模扩大,单体架构带来的维护困难、部署风险等问题愈发明显。采用微服务架构已成为主流趋势,它能有效支持不同模块独立开发、部署与扩展。以Spring Cloud为基础框架,结合Nacos实现服务注册与发现,使用Feign进行服务间调用,配合Gateway作为统一入口,可以构建出高可用、易维护的系统底座。同时,考虑到外部系统对接需求,如与ERP、WMS、TMS或第三方支付平台的集成,开放API接口设计至关重要。通过定义标准化的RESTful接口规范,并引入OAuth2.0认证机制,既能保障数据交互的安全性,又能提升跨系统协作的灵活性。此外,对于高频查询类场景,如库存状态实时查看,可借助Redis缓存中间件降低数据库压力,显著提升用户体验。
功能选型:让系统具备“智能决策”能力
一个优秀的SCM系统,不应仅停留在流程记录层面,而应在关键节点提供智能辅助。例如,在采购环节引入智能推荐算法,根据历史价格、交货周期、供应商评分自动推荐最优采购对象;在库存管理中,利用时间序列分析模型预测未来7天或30天的需求波动,动态调整安全库存阈值;在物流调度方面,结合地理围栏与实时交通数据,自动规划最优配送路线。这些功能的实现,离不开Elasticsearch这类全文检索与数据分析引擎的支持。通过构建可视化看板,将库存周转率、订单履约准时率、供应商交付合格率等核心指标以图表形式呈现,帮助管理层快速掌握全局态势,做出科学决策。
技术栈搭配:兼顾稳定性与可扩展性
技术选型直接影响系统的长期生命力。推荐采用以Java为主语言的Spring Boot + Spring Cloud生态,其社区活跃、文档齐全、组件丰富,适合中大型企业级应用开发。前端可选用Vue.js或React框架,配合Element UI或Ant Design组件库,快速搭建现代化操作界面。数据库方面,关系型数据库(如MySQL)用于存储结构化业务数据,非关系型数据库(如MongoDB)则适用于日志、配置等灵活字段较多的场景。消息队列(如Kafka)可用于异步处理大量订单事件,避免系统阻塞。整体技术组合既保证了系统的稳定运行,也为未来功能迭代预留充足空间。
应对实操难点:从技术落地到组织变革
尽管技术层面有成熟方案,但在实际推进过程中仍面临诸多挑战。首先是跨部门数据标准不统一,财务、仓储、销售等部门使用的编码规则、单位换算方式各异,导致数据整合困难。解决之道在于建立统一的数据治理规范,由专人牵头制定主数据管理体系,强制推行字段命名、单位、分类编码的一致性。其次是历史系统对接问题,旧有系统可能采用封闭协议或私有格式,难以直接接入新平台。此时宜采取渐进式迁移策略,先通过ETL工具抽取关键数据,再分批次导入新系统,确保业务连续性。最后是用户接受度问题,部分员工习惯于原有工作方式,对新系统存在抵触心理。建议开展分角色培训,针对不同岗位设计操作手册与模拟演练场景,辅以激励机制推动使用习惯转变。
预期成效:从量化指标看系统价值
当一套完整的SCM系统开发完成后,企业将在多个维度收获切实收益。据行业实践数据显示,系统上线后平均可实现库存周转率提升25%,这意味着资金占用减少、资产利用率提高;订单履约周期缩短30%,客户满意度随之上升;人工操作成本下降40%,尤其在重复性高的录入、核对、通知等环节,自动化替代显著减轻人力负担。更重要的是,系统提供的实时洞察力,使企业能够更快识别异常、预警风险,从而在突发情况下迅速调整策略,增强抗压能力。
对于正在考虑推进供应链数字化升级的企业而言,从零开始的SCM系统开发并非遥不可及。只要把握住需求定位、架构设计、功能落地与组织协同四大关键环节,就能走出一条符合自身发展节奏的自主建设之路。这不仅是一次技术革新,更是对企业运营模式的深层次重构。未来,谁能率先完成供应链的智能化转型,谁就将在激烈的市场竞争中占据主动权。而这一切的起点,正是扎实可靠的“SCM系统开发”实践。我们专注于为企业提供定制化、可落地的SCM系统开发服务,拥有丰富的行业经验与成熟的技术团队,致力于帮助企业打通供应链全链路数据壁垒,实现高效协同与智能决策,欢迎随时联系18140119082获取详细方案与技术支持。


